Ticket: Config drift on Marlowe Clinic reminder job

Hey, welcome aboard! Quick one for you: the appointment reminder job for the Marlowe Clinic pilot has drifted from what's in the repo. Someone hand-edited the scheduler node last month and never committed it, so staging and prod now disagree on send windows and retry counts. Could you reconcile them this week? Don't guess — just match prod to what's documented. The values currently running in production are listed below.

deployment values, yadug-bawif:
[framir]
team = pelox
access_code = ac_a38ab2
owner = tamion.julael
host = framir.tolvaqlabs.test
port = 11211
peer = tammir.zemvargrid.local
salt = 2215ef03
pin = 1541

# Launch Plan: Ferncrest 2.0 — Managers Only

Launch date: April 14. Branches receive demo units April 1. Staff training mandatory by April 10; materials on the Hollis drive. Pricing: hold at list, no promos first 30 days. Messaging: lead with battery life, avoid comparisons to Ardent's lineup until legal clears claims. Escalate supply issues to regional ops, not HQ. Press embargo lifts April 13. Do not discuss externally. Strategic context is in the note below.

board note of baweg-bawig: Project Tamath slips by six weeks because of the audit delay.

**CI note: fan-out backpressure test timeouts**

The Quencefeed notification fan-out suite times out when the mock broker's queue depth exceeds 50k. Root cause: the backpressure shed threshold in CI config lags the prod value. Patch lands tonight; until then, rerun with the reduced-depth profile. Ignore single-shard timeout noise. Reference the affected pipeline by the trace token below.

session token of bawep-yadup = htk21_528abd376e3c5a4ec24a1

## v2.8.0 — Canary gating update

Heads up, plugin folks: Glimmerhost now blocks canary promotion if your plugin's error rate climbs above 0.5% during the bake window. No more sneaking past with a quick retry loop — the gate checks rolling averages. Update your manifests to declare health endpoints before the next release train. Questions about gating rules go to our canary lead.

account owner for yahog-kafop: Istius Rusix